Rock Creek Gas Plant is an EPA Toxics Release Inventory reporter in Borger, TX, in the natural gas processing sector. It reported 314 lbs of releases across 2 chemicals in 2023, and 661 lbs in total across its 2022-2023 reporting years. That ranks 14,433 of 25,986 TRI facilities nationwide by cumulative reported pounds, counting each facility over however many years it has filed. Annual disclosure change
What changed: EPA TRI 2023 reporting year
- Rock Creek Gas Plant's total reported releases fell from 347 lb in 2022 to 314 lb in 2023, based on EPA TRI filings.
- Rock Creek Gas Plant's chemicals reported fell from 3 in 2022 to 2 in 2023, based on EPA TRI filings.
- Rock Creek Gas Plant's air releases fell from 347 lb in 2022 to 314 lb in 2023, based on EPA TRI filings.
